Output 51215affc6780faf38cce5bbb51497ddeb6949dbe930587f63befebbe021fcae:3

value
24500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b3c6822b648669a41d665edd5d8baceb03eaefb OP_EQUAL
address
A6b5mG3BjMs3LMX21wmJpUGA7Dqv1rvoTZ
transaction
51215affc6780faf38cce5bbb51497ddeb6949dbe930587f63befebbe021fcae